WebJul 16, 2013 · Tony Ray-Jones, born in Wokey Wells, Somerset, 7 June 1941, was christened Holroyd Anthony Ray-Jones. Holroyd is a family name and was taken from his godfather and uncle but Tony preferred always to use his shortened second name. His father. a distinguished painter and etcher, died when Tony was eight months old.

WebAug 23, 2024 · Icons of Photography: Tony Ray-Jones. Tony Ray-Jones was born on June 7, 1941, in the Somerset cathedral city of Wells. At least, that’s what the books generally say. In fact, it was up the road in the village of Wookey – close to Toomey Hole, the tourist attraction based around the caves in which that most English of cheeses, …
